What it costs

Sewage Mold Remediation cost in Mantoloking, NJ

Every job is different, so here are the typical New Jersey ranges we see. These are planning numbers, not a quote.

Small area
$500 to $1,500

A single moldy spot, a closet, or under a sink. We contain it, remove it, and treat the surface.

One room
$1,500 to $3,500

A bathroom, kitchen, or bedroom with mold on a wall or ceiling, plus the moisture source fixed.

Basement, attic, or crawl space
$2,000 to $6,000

Larger areas that need more containment and drying. Common here after spring rain or a slow leak.

Whole-house or severe
$10,000 and up

Mold across several rooms or after major water damage. We work in phases, room by room.

Sewage Mold Remediation in Mantoloking, NJ: common questions

Is a sewage backup more dangerous than a regular water leak?

Yes, sewage contamination carries health hazards a clean water leak doesn't, which is why porous materials are typically removed rather than dried and reused.

Does sewage cause mold faster than clean water?

The combination of moisture and organic contamination can create favorable conditions for mold to develop quickly, so fast response matters.

Will insurance cover a sewage backup?

Coverage depends on your specific policy, sometimes requiring a sewer backup rider. We document the damage thoroughly to support your claim.

Should I try to clean up a sewage backup myself?

It's best to avoid direct contact and call a professional crew, since proper protective equipment and disposal practices are important for safety.

What materials do you remove after a sewage backup?

Porous materials like carpet, carpet padding, and drywall that contacted sewage are generally removed and disposed of rather than cleaned in place.
